How does Litecoin's proof of work system function?
Can you explain in detail how Litecoin's proof of work system functions and how it differs from other cryptocurrencies?
3 answers
- Dhanushka WijesingheDec 18, 2021 · 5 years agoSure! Litecoin's proof of work system is based on the Scrypt algorithm, which is different from Bitcoin's SHA-256 algorithm. Scrypt is designed to be memory-intensive, which means it requires a large amount of memory to solve the cryptographic puzzles and mine new blocks. This makes it more resistant to ASIC mining, which is the use of specialized hardware to mine cryptocurrencies. By using Scrypt, Litecoin aims to promote a more decentralized mining ecosystem where individuals can still mine using consumer-grade hardware.
